MP40🇩🇪 VS Thompson🇺🇸 The MP40 has: 1. A slower rate of fire. 2. Less recoil and muzzle rise. 3. Weights much less. 4. Magazine changes are faster because of the magazine well. 5. Is easier to 'point' ie hit your target fast. 6. Stock folds for compactness when not in use or riding in a vehicle. 7. Bolt handle is on the left side making it easier to use for right handers. 8. Bolt can be locked back to help prevent accident discharge if gun is dropped. 9. Magazine carries 2 more rounds than a TSMG. 10. Hooded front sight is better protected vs TSMG and aids in the guns 'pointability.' The TSMG has: 1. A more powerful round in the 45ACP. 2. Stonger milled steel receiver. 3. Magazines that are much easier/faster to load.

The MP-38 was a perfect example of German over-engineering when it came to something as simple as a SMG. However, after a few years they listened to the feed-back of troops and then came out with the MP-40. Regardless, the MP-38 is the Holy Grail when it comes to German over-engineering of WW2 German Maschinenpistole I:E; the MP-38. And why it fetch a very high premium when an original (C&R) and transferable on a Form-4 comes up for sale here in the States. The MP-38 is truly a work of art when it comes to over-engineering something as a bullet-hose. By the way I can tell from the trigger guard that your MP-40 was made by Erma....does it have a Waffemamp manufacture code of AYF on the butt end of the receiver?

In British WW2 parlance all German sub machine guns were Schmeissers and all (heavy?) machine guns were Spandau's. It was accurate enough at the time but its a catch-all that's continued to this day 👍
